Starbucks offers Starbucks brands only. Your brand would have to sign a distribution deal before that would happen.
Because they are COFFEE houses. They do sell herbal tea. Most people have never heard of teecino, therefore it wouldn’t be a big seller. Starbucks is in this to make money.
Starbucks Coffee doesn’t carry coffee substitutes because they position themselves as a high end coffee retailer.
Starbucks selling coffee substitute would be like Ruth’s Chris Steakhouse selling veggie burgers.
It would diminish the brand.

And Teecino is not a natural alternative to coffee. Coffee is a natural product. It’s an herbal alternative to coffee, designed for those who enjoy coffee but can’t tolerate the caffeine that is found (naturally) in coffee beans.
Just because the marketer says it’s an “herbal coffee” or “coffee alternative” doesn’t mean that it is. There is a reason they are vehement in their stance that it is not a “coffee substitute”. It’s a marketing ploy.
